The Shannon Rose Irish Pub and the Kohler Distributing Company recently presented a $5,526 check to St. Jude Children’s Research Hospital, according to a joint statement from the businesses.
According to the statement, the money was raised during the third annual Punkin Chunkin competition at the pub’s Clifton and Ramsey locations. The competition challenged participants to test their strength by launching pumpkins into the “Chunkin Patch” for the chance to win prizes.
The restaurant added to it’s the fundraiser by donating a portion of the sales of pumpkin-themed menu items made available at both pubs, according to the statement, which said the Kohler Distributing Company then matched the pubs’ donations.
According to the statement, the pubs and distributing company presented the check to the research hospital on Nov. 17. The money will go toward St. Jude’s mission to advance cures and means of prevention for pediatric diseases through research and treatment.
